ใน PHP bcscale() ฟังก์ชั่นใช้เพื่อตั้งค่าพารามิเตอร์เริ่มต้นสำหรับ คณิตศาสตร์ bc . ทั้งหมด ฟังก์ชัน . ฟังก์ชันนี้ตั้งค่าพารามิเตอร์มาตราส่วนเริ่มต้นสำหรับการเรียกต่อไปนี้ทั้งหมดไปยังฟังก์ชันคณิตศาสตร์ bc ที่ไม่ได้ระบุพารามิเตอร์มาตราส่วนอย่างชัดเจน
ไวยากรณ์
int bcscale($scale)
พารามิเตอร์
$bcscale() พารามิเตอร์ยอมรับพารามิเตอร์เดียวเท่านั้นและเป็นพารามิเตอร์ประเภทจำนวนเต็มบังคับ พารามิเตอร์นี้แสดงจำนวนหลักที่อยู่หลังทศนิยม ค่าเริ่มต้นคือ 0
ผลตอบแทนที่ได้รับ
$bcscale() ฟังก์ชันส่งคืนค่ามาตราส่วนเก่า
ตัวอย่างที่ 1
<?php // default scale : 5 bcscale(5); // The default scale value as 5 echo bcadd('107', '6.5596'), "\n"; // this is not the same without bcscale() echo bcadd('107', '6.55957', 1), "\n"; // the default scale value as 5 echo bcadd('107', '6.55957'), "\n"; ?>
ผลลัพธ์
113.55960 113.5 113.55957
ตัวอย่างที่ 2
<?php // set default scale 5 bcscale(5); // set the default scale value as 5 echo bcadd('107', '6.5596'), "\n"; // this is not the same without bcscale() echo bcadd('107', '6.55957', 1), "\n"; // Changed the default scale value bcscale(3); // the default scale value as 5 echo bcadd('107', '6.55957'), "\n"; ?>
ผลลัพธ์
113.55960 113.55 113.559